jsでのキーボードイベントの簡単な説明

怪我咯
リリース: 2017-07-06 11:36:46
オリジナル
1760 人が閲覧しました

この記事は主にjsのキーボードイベントを紹介し、比較的簡単な例の形でキーボードイベントに応じたjsの操作スキルを分析します。必要な友達はそれを参照してください

この記事はjsのキーボードイベントを分析します。例。皆さんの参考に共有してください。具体的な分析は次のとおりです:

この例の効果:

キーボードの任意のキーを押すと、IE、Chrome、Firefox と互換性のある対応する ASCII コードがポップアップ表示されます。

しかし、まだ多くの問題があります:

(1) IE と Chrome では、上、下、左、右などの一部のキーが機能しません。
(2) Firefox では、右のキーと一重引用符キーは 39 には影響しません。

具体的なコードは次のとおりです:

コードは次のとおりです:

<html>
<head>
<script type="text/javascript">
 window.onload = function(){
  var bd = document.getElementsByTagName(&#39;body&#39;)[0];
  bd.onkeypress = function(ev){
   ev = ev || window.event;//ie不支持function参数ev
   alert(ev.keyCode || ev.which);//火狐不支持keyCode
  }
 }
</script>
<style type="text/css">
#par{width:300px;height:200px;background:gray;}
#son{width:200px;height:100px;background:green;}
</style>
</head>
<body>
<p id="par">
 <p id="son"></p>
</p>
</body>
</html>
ログイン後にコピー

以上がjsでのキーボードイベントの簡単な説明の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ート
私たちについて 免責事項 Sitemap
PHP中国語ウェブサイト:福祉オンライン PHP トレーニング,PHP 学習者の迅速な成長を支援します!